Aluminum Electrolytic Capacitors consisting of Nichicon UVY2A222MRD are made from two sheets of aluminum foil and a piece of electrolyte-soaked paper. The Nichicon UVY2A222MRD' anode aluminum foil is anodized on one side to generate a weak layer of oxide, and the cathode aluminum foil is non-anodized; the anode and cathode are separated by electrolyte-soaked paper. The Nichicon UVY2A222MRD from Aluminum Electrolytic Capacitors is found in many applications such as computer motherboards and power supplies and is ideal when large capacitance is required, and current leakage isn't a significant factor.
